Technical Specifications
Fuel Petrol Petrol
Engine Displacement 115.00 cc 97.20 cc
Engine -- Air cooled, 4 - Stroke Single Cylinder OHC
Engine Starting Kick Start Electric and Kick Start
Clutch -- Multiplate wet type
Cooling System -- Air Cooled
Maximum Power 8.6 PS @ 7000 rpm 8.36 Ps @ 8000 rpm
Maximum Torque 9.81 Nm @ 5000 rpm 8.05 Nm @ 5000 rpm
Transmission 4-speed 4-Speed Constant Mesh
Gear Shift Pattern 1-N-2-3-4 1-N-2-3-4
Battery -- 12V - 2.5Ah (Kick) / 12V - 3Ah MF
Frame -- Tubular Double Cradle Type
Headlamp -- 12 V - 35 / 35 W - Halogen Bulb (Multi-Reflector Type)
Taillamp -- 12V - 5/10 W (Multi-Reflector)
